2601 lec 10 gas exchange i: principles and breathing in water. Metabolism is dependent on the exchange of the following from the environment. Something that absorbs or takes up something from atmosphere around. Diffusion alone is too slow to maintain the rates of gas exchange needed to support the metabolism of larger organisms. Sink: diffusion effective for small distances, surface area to volume ration affects diffusion ability. Oxygen diffuses out of sea water into cells. Water sucked through pores on sides and forced out to center (all these little hairs that are. Sea water circulates out of body cavity by means of bulk flow. Like squeezing toothpaste helping propel the water) see diagram of sponge thing. Getting oxygen out of the external medium and into the cells: often via the circulatory system. Getting carbon dioxide out of the cells and into the external medium. Cold seawater: ~. 8% oxygen in solution cold holds more than hot.
